Operation Cookie Returns to South Pasadena to Honor Veterans with Sweet Surprises

Thousands of homemade cookies to be delivered to hospitalized, homeless, and special needs veterans during heartfelt Memorial Day tribute.

In celebration of Memorial Day, “Operation Cookie” will once again bring warmth and appreciation to hospitalized, homeless, and special needs veterans across Southern California. The event takes place on Wednesday, May 21, from 8:30 a.m. to noon at the Woman’s Club of South Pasadena, located at 1424 Fremont Avenue.

Community Rallies with Cookies and Compassion

Volunteers and cookie donors from all over the Greater Los Angeles area will gather early in the morning to drop off thousands of homemade cookies. Curbside cookie drop-off begins at 7:00 a.m., and the peak of activity will take place between 9:00 and 11:00 a.m., when dozens of volunteers will work side-by-side on the “cookie assembly line” to package the treats for delivery.

Veterans Join the Effort

Adding to the significance of the event, several veterans—including a World War II veteran and multiple Vietnam veterans—will assist in the packaging process. Their participation makes the gesture even more meaningful and offers an opportunity for powerful storytelling and visual coverage just ahead of Memorial Day.

A Longstanding Tradition of Gratitude

Held annually in conjunction with Memorial Day, Operation Cookie is a heartfelt tribute organized by the Woman’s Club of South Pasadena. The event aims to honor those who have served by delivering cookies—and a reminder of community appreciation—to local VA hospitals, transitional housing facilities, and veteran support centers.
